Abstract
The invention is applicable to the field of communication, and provides an automatic world clock replacing method based on a mobile terminal device, and the method comprises the following steps of establishing a world clock database according to the division of global time zones; displaying a preset world clock group through a widget application program; starting a positioning function of the mobile terminal device; acquiring a city in which the current mobile terminal device stays through the positioning function; judging whether the city in which the current mobile terminal device stays exists in the displayed preset world clock group or not; and searching for a world clock in the world clock database to automatically replace one world clock in the preset world clock group if the city in which the current mobile terminal device does not exist in the displayed preset world clock group. The invention also provides an automatic world clock replacing system based on the mobile terminal device. Due to the adoption of the automatic world clock replacing method and system based on the mobile terminal device, the world clock can be automatically adjusted so as to be convenient for users to accurately acquire the local time.

See also Fig. 1, for the World clock of movement-based terminal device in an embodiment of the present invention is changed method flow diagram automatically.In the present embodiment, the method is realized by mobile terminal device.
In step S101, set up the World clock database according to the division of whole world time zone, wherein, described World clock database comprises the corresponding conversion relation between the World clock of World clock, World clock city title and different time zone in each time zone, the whole world.
In the present embodiment, the World clock database comprises that the whole world is divided into the corresponding conversion relation between the World clock of World clock city title corresponding to World clock, each time zone in 24 time zones and different time zone by longitude.Bright for instance, the World clock database comprises the World clock (being Beijing time) that is positioned at eastern eight time zones, the World clock (being the Tokyo time) in nine time zones, east, the World clock (being the New York time) in five time zones, west etc., the World clock database also comprises the World clock city title that each time zone is corresponding, Beijing for example, Tokyo, New York etc., the World clock database also comprises the corresponding conversion relation between the World clock of different time zone, for example, be that May is during 12:00 on the 1st when the Tokyo time, Beijing time=time zone, time place, 12:00-(Tokyo number-time zone, Beijing time place number)=12:00-(9-8)=11:00, that is to say the Tokyo time be May 1 12:00 with respect to the 11:00 on May 1 of Beijing time, just the relation of the corresponding conversion between the World clock of all different time zones is not done one by one not illustrate at this.
In step S102, show default World clock group by the widget application program.In the present embodiment, preset the World clock group and comprise at least the two worlds clock, wherein, show that default World clock group comprises the real-time World clock that demonstration is current, and show the World clock city title corresponding with real-time World clock, as shown in Figure 2.
See also Fig. 2, for showing the synoptic diagram of default World clock group in an embodiment of the present invention.As shown in Figure 2, default World clock group comprises New York time and London time two worlds clock, show that default World clock group comprises the real-time World clock that demonstration is current, current such as the New York time is the current 7:19AM of being of 2:19AM, London time, show that simultaneously default World clock group also comprises the World clock city title that demonstration is corresponding with real-time World clock, namely " New York " " London " can allow the user intuitively understand the current real-time time of the different World clocks in default World clock group like this.
Certainly, in default World clock group, can also comprise plural World clock, this can be set by user's needs, equally also can show the default World clock group that comprises plural World clock by the widget application program, in this for example explanation that just differs.
Please continue to consult Fig. 1, in step S103, open the positioning function of mobile terminal device.In the present embodiment, this positioning function is specially the GPS positioning function, and perhaps WiFi positioning function specifically realizes positioning function by being arranged in the mobile terminal device GPS locating module or WiFi locating module.
In step S104, obtain the residing city of current mobile terminal equipment by positioning function.In the present embodiment, then place, the current city latitude and longitude value that specifically can be got access to by GPS locating module or WiFi locating module first compares to obtain residing city with the corresponding data in the latitude and longitude value that gets access to and each city longitude and latitude tabulation of the world.
In step S105, judge whether the residing city of current mobile terminal equipment that gets access to is present in the default World clock group of current demonstration.In the present embodiment, if default World clock group comprises the two worlds clock, take Fig. 2 as example, so just judge whether the residing city of current mobile terminal equipment that gets access to is present in the default World clock group shown in Figure 2.
In step S106, if judging, step S105 do not exist, then in clock data storehouse, the world, search for the World clock corresponding with the residing city of current mobile terminal equipment that gets access to, and with one of them World clock in the default World clock group of the World clock automatic replacement that searches, show simultaneously the World clock after replacing.Describe as an example of Fig. 2 example, be " Beijing " if obtain the residing city of current mobile terminal equipment by positioning function among the step S104, step S105 judgement does not exist so, at this moment in step S106, then in clock data storehouse, the world, search for the World clock (being Beijing time) corresponding with " Beijing " city, and with one of them World clock in the default World clock group of World clock (the being Beijing time) automatic replacement that searches, for example Beijing time can be replaced " New York " time or replacement " London " time, show simultaneously the Beijing time after replacing.
In the present embodiment, exist if step S105 judges, then continue to show default World clock group by the widget application program, shown in step S102, in this just not repeat specification.
